Time on Home Screen in PST, Everything Else in EST?

So I have my profile set to GMT-5. And that's what all posts in all fora show.

But on the teasers section of the home screen, it's in GMT-8.

What gives?

The thing is that it's not easy to fix. The forum loads all of its pages dynamically based on a ton of variables. One of those variables is the time zone setting that you have set in your profile. You see everything in Eastern Time because that's what you have your preferences set to.

The front page doesn't work that way. It's built every 3 minutes by the server and cached. It knows nothing about your time zone when it does it, or even if you're a logged in user or not-- it displays the page that it put together on it's last build.

We could change it to print times relative to the current time, like "posted 2 mins ago", but that really kills part of the point in caching it. It's just more processing that has to be done to figure out what needs to be displayed on the page.

I'm open to suggestions.
